Enhancement of the Simon effect by response precuing

Summary
Response precuing, not attentional precuing, enhances the Simon effect. This suggests the Simon effect arises from response selection processes rather than stimulus identification.

Background:
- The Simon effect occurs when response times are faster if stimulus location matches response location, even when location is irrelevant.
- Attentional and intentional precues can influence cognitive task performance.
- Previous research suggests a role for response selection in the Simon effect.
Purpose of the Study:
- To investigate the differential impact of attentional versus intentional precues on the Simon effect.
- To clarify the underlying mechanisms of the Simon effect, specifically distinguishing between stimulus identification and response selection accounts.
Main Methods:
- Replication of a prior study (Verfaellie et al., 1988) using attentional and intentional precues.
- Modified experimental procedures isolating the effects of attentional and intentional precues.
- Experiments involving crossed and uncrossed hand configurations with multiple stimuli per response.
Main Results:
- The Simon effect was significantly enhanced by intentional precues (signaling response location).
- Attentional precues (signaling stimulus location) did not significantly affect the Simon effect.
- The enhancement by intentional precues persisted across different experimental setups and response assignments.
Conclusions:
- Response precuing plays a crucial role in modulating the Simon effect.
- Findings support response-selection theories of the Simon effect over stimulus-identification theories.
- The study underscores the importance of response preparation in cognitive tasks.
